Shire River, British Central Dr. Iercy Rendall. measurements The RED RIVER-HOG (Potamochoerus porcus). In this species the prominences on the skulls of adult boars areflat-topped, and do not reach above the line of the nose ; the colour isalways some shade of rufous, either shining brownish red with a tingeof yellow, or dark reddish yellow with black on the forehead, ears, andlimbs, and the mane of the back, part of the margins of the ears, thetips of the long tufts of hairs with which they are surmounted, andstreaks above and below the eyes white. Distribution.—West Africa. FOREST-HOG 457. Head of Forest-Hug. Shot by J. W . Vardley. The FOREST-HOG (Hylochoerus meinertzhageni). A huge black pig serving in some respects to connect the bush-pigswith the wart-hogs, although markedly distinct from both. Height atshoulder, 26 ins.; weight, i 16 lbs. clean (Major P. H. G. Powell-Cotton). Distribuiio7i.—Kenia and the Nandi Forest, but represented by anallied species or race in the Eastern Cameruns, and a third in theIturi Forest. Upper Tusks. TotalLength.
